Alice was a good friend of Maggie Smith and when Smith won an Oscar in 1969 for her starring role in ''The Prime of Miss Jean Brodie'' and was unable to attend, Ghostley accepted the Oscar on her behalf.

Later Ghostley's character "Esmerelda" was introduced as a regular on the series in 1969, after the May 1968 death of [[Marion Lorne]], the actress who played the lovable-but-befuddled "Aunt Clara". The studio wanted another comedic-actress to be introduced to the series to replace her, but in a different role.  Esmerelda is typically summoned when Samantha needs a babysitter.  She is a shy bundle-of-nerves who often fades slowly away when nervous.  When she isn't nervous her spell-casting is often very good, but when she is nervous all havoc breaks loose.
